Output ffbab24b7ab02e21281b011fad1aa6fb100737a28f78a3b682b83fee1fca4ab3:8

value
40407908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1798bb256c8e88fd50eb9f738e18921e27e77e8 OP_EQUAL
address
3HsR8e6L48dVmUXabTRvTW6c3tEpzVJYCd
transaction
ffbab24b7ab02e21281b011fad1aa6fb100737a28f78a3b682b83fee1fca4ab3
spent
true